2. Prerequisites

  • Before starting the deployment, confirm the following are in place:
    1. SharePoint environment: Microsoft 365 tenant with SharePoint Online and App Catalog enabled.
    2. App Catalog site: A tenant-level or site-collection App Catalog must be created and accessible.
    3. Admin access: Global Administrator or SharePoint Administrator rights are required for tenant-level deployment and for approving API permissions.
    4. Target site: A modern SharePoint site (communication or team site) designated to host the classifieds and marketplace experience.

Step 1: Deploy the Solution (Admin)

Step 2: Grant API Access

  • CV Classified requires delegated Microsoft Graph permissions to read user profiles, manage classified listings stored in SharePoint lists, and dispatch notification emails for new posts, approvals, and replies.
  • Open the SharePoint Admin Center: https://yourtenant-admin.sharepoint.com
  • From the left menu, navigate to Advanced → API access.
  • Under Pending requests, locate the following permission requests submitted by CV Classified:
    1. Mail.Send
    2. User.Read
  • Select permission and click Approve. Approval can take a few minutes to propagate across the tenant.

Step 3: Add the App to a SharePoint Site

  • Note: Skip this step if you selected “Enable this app and add it to all sites” in the previous step.
  • Navigate to the target SharePoint site collection (for example, your intranet, employee hub, or community site).
  • Open Site Contents from the site settings menu.
  • Click + New → App in the top ribbon.
  • Under Apps You Can Add, select CV Classified and click Add.

5. Part 2 — Configure the CV Classified Web Part

  • Once the app is installed, add the web part to a SharePoint page so employees and administrators can post, browse, and moderate classified listings from a single experience.

Step 1: Create the Classifieds Page

  • From the target site, go to Site Contents → New → Page.
  • Select a blank page template and give it a clear title such as “Classifieds”, “Employee Marketplace”, or “Community Board”.
  • Add a full-width section (recommended) so the listing grid, category filters, and post form render with adequate horizontal space.
  • Optionally pin this page to the site’s top navigation so users can access classifieds directly from the site header.

Step 2: Add the Web Part

  • Click the + icon inside the section to open the web-part picker.
  • Search for “CV Classified” and select the result. Wait a few seconds for the web part to initialize.

Step 3: Add Configuration Setup from settings

  • Click settings tab from navigation menu.
  • Configure the following on first use:
    1. General settings – Expire listings, terms of use, upload image mandatory or not, form fields, header customization, tab taxonomy, quick actions.
    2. Approval settings – Manage admin users, inventory feature enable, post approval notifications with email template customize
    3. Meta data settings – Manage currency, category, country, city, state

Step 4: Test and Publish

  • Click Publish in the top-right of the page to make it available to all users.
  • Optionally add the page to the site’s top navigation and any hub navigation for easy discovery across your SharePoint environment.

7. Part 4 — CV Classified Automate – Installation & Configuration Steps

  • CV Classified Automate enables Auto delete features such as delete listing after certain days using Microsoft Power Automate.

Step 1: Install Power Automate Solution

  • Go to Power Automate https://make.powerautomate.com
  • Sign in with your Microsoft account
  • Select the correct Environment (same as SharePoint)
  • Navigate to Solutions from the left menu
  • Click on Open App Source
  • Click On Get it Now Button
  • Select an environment, check the box, and then click Install
  • Alternatively, Option: Install Using the Shared Package
  • Click on import solution from top menu.
  • Drag/Drop or import automate solution shared by CV Support team.

Step 2: Set up Solution and Environment variable

  • Open Power Automate or click on this link: https://make.powerautomate.com
  • Select the same environment where you installed CV Classified Automate
  • In Left menu Select Solution
  • Find CV Classified
  • Click on Update Environment variable
  • Configure required connections:
    1. SharePoint
  • Sign in and authorize all connections
  • Set up the environment variables by selecting the appropriate values from the
    dropdown, then click Save and Close.

Step 3: Enable Flows

  • Go to Cloud Flows inside the solution
  • Open each flow
  • Click Turn On
  • Ensure all flows are enabled successfully
  • Flow will be triggered on daily basis as per scheduled time
